Book description
This second edition of Communicating in the 21st Century (C21) is the most comprehensive, flexible and affordable resource package ever developed in the field of communication in Australia. Significantly, it is an original work, not an adaptation of a US or UK text. The author, Baden Eunson, had drawn on decades of experience in education and industry, building on the success of the first edition of this text to deliver a total learning package.

Comprehensive and highly referenced coverage of communication theory is balanced with a wealth of practical skill activities, and the text is written in a user-friendly, accessible style that is perfectly complemented by informative illustrations. Each of its 22 chapters is a tightly structured learning unit based on specific objectives, and includes self-assessment tasks, ethical dilemma case studies, review questions and applied exercises. In addition, a further 8 chapters on specialised communication topics are available online.

Well-developed interpersonal and communication skills are increasingly in demand by employers in all industries. In today's competitive career market, C21 is the perfect tool for students, lecturers and professionals.

About the author
Baden Eunson
teaches in the School of English, Communications and Performance Studies at Monash University, and runs a training and consultancy business.
